NCAA Game Summary - Arizona State At Oregon State
Saturday, March 8, 2008
Corvallis, OR -- (Sports Network) - Ty Abbott scored 18 points and grabbed eight rebounds to lead the Arizona State Sun Devils to a 77-64 victory over the Oregon State Beavers in a Pac-10 tilt at Gill Coliseum. Eric Boateng and Jamelle McMillan tallied 12 points apiece in the win for Arizona State (19-11, 9-9 Pac-10). Lathen Wallace posted a game-high 22 points to pace Oregon State (6-24, 0-18), while Marcel Jones tallied 14 points to go with six rebounds in the losing effort. The Sun Devils held Oregon State to a meager 31.0 percent shooting clip from the floor during the first period to open a 38-30 halftime lead. Arizona State shot at a blazing 61.1 percent during the second stanza en route to the 13-point victory. The Beavers shot just 33.8 percent from the floor, including 13-of-39 from long range, in the loss.
